The company retains a Market Volatility (i.e., Beta) of 0.1, which attests to not very significant fluctuations relative to the market. As returns on the market increase, George Weston's returns are expected to increase less than the market. However, during the bear market, the loss of holding George Weston is expected to be smaller as well. At this point, George Weston 520 has a negative expected return of -0.0221%. George Weston Limited engages in the food processing and distribution business in Canada and internationally. George Weston Limited is a subsidiary of Wittington Investments, Ltd. GEORGE WESTON operates under Grocery Stores classification in Canada and is traded on Toronto Stock Exchange. It employs 203238 people.Things to note about George Weston 520 performance evaluation
